The middle change in undeniable terms

Trimming shapes and reduces foliage, quite often for immediate visual appeal or clearance. Think of it as cosmetic relief or tidy edges. Pruning guides shape and wellbeing by way of casting off one of a kind branches at particular points so the tree grows more desirable through the years. Good pruning makes use of the tree’s biology in your expertise. It respects branch collars, anticipates load distribution, and assists in keeping the tree’s usual architecture intact.

Both use saws and both get rid of eco-friendly progress, however the resolution standards are assorted. When I trim, I’m answering “How an awful lot do I need to take off to meet this line clearance or view requirement?” When I prune, I’m asking “Which cuts will cut menace, stay away from rubbing, and manage sturdy scaffold branches 5 years from now?”

How bushes reply, and why your cuts matter

Trees compartmentalize wounds rather than heal them like animal tissue. When you're making a minimize, the tree isolates the injured section in the back of walls of new tissue and chemistry. That procedure works just right while the reduce is simply backyard the department collar, leaves the department bark ridge intact, and doesn’t rip bark. Trim with indiscriminate shearing or flush cuts and you create long stubs or widespread floor places that close slowly, inviting moisture and decay fungi.

A tree also balances its cover with its roots. Remove too much foliage in one move and also you disrupt that stability. The trouble-free reaction is a surge of epicormic shoots - skinny, quickly development reaching for faded. These shoots are weakly connected and break in storms. Over trimming junipers, laurels, or maples is a speedy course to a bushy mess in a year’s time. Pruning, with the aid of comparison, respects the rule of thumb of thirds. On harassed or mature trees, I avert taking extra than about 15 to twenty p.c. of stay crown in a season, and I unfold structural paintings over numerous years.

Where trimming suits: appearances, clearance, and hobbies containment

There is nothing inherently incorrect with trimming whilst it’s completed with restraint. On yes species and in specified contexts, it’s the good cross.

  • For hedges, monitors, and tightly clumping shrubs, trimming holds a line and continues development in bounds. Privet, boxwood, and photinia tolerate shearing and get better without structural penalty.
  • Around walkways and driveways, trimming a handful of extending department recommendations improves clearance without overhauling the overall tree.
  • Under application strains or roof eaves, trimming can speedily limit conflicts. I nonetheless choose selective reduction cuts over uniform shearing, yet at times entry and finances level to a cautious trim.

If I trim a broadleaf tree, I do it with reduction cuts back to laterals, now not shears. That preserves ordinary shape at the same time shortening achieve. The greater you put off out at the suggestions with out regard for a lateral, the extra full of life and volatile the regrowth could be.

Where pruning matches: constitution, protection, and longevity

Pruning is the craft area of the paintings. It’s diagnostic and deliberate. Before I prune, I stroll the tree and learn its story: where the triumphing winds hit, which branches rub, wherein sun gaps inspire heavy increase, and how the trunk tapers. Pruning makes the so much distinction while:

  • You need fewer typhoon screw ups. Removing deadwood, crossing branches, and vulnerable co-dominant stems reduces leverage and elements of friction.
  • You wish superior fruit and vegetation. Thinning cuts raise easy and air in the cover, which reduces ailment and improves fruit dimension and coloration in apples, pears, and peaches.
  • You favor to set a younger tree on a robust direction. A few good located cuts in years 2 to five construct a solid scaffold and remove future dangers.

In observe, pruning pivots round 3 cuts: thinning, relief, and removal. Thinning cuts take a whole department to come back to its origin, beginning the canopy. Reduction cuts shorten a department by slicing to come back to a lateral that may be in any case a 3rd the diameter of the dad or mum. Removal cuts take out a defective or poorly located branch fullyyt. Done effectively, these cuts depart the department collar intact and give the tree a suited possibility to seal.

Timing will never be just a calendar note

I see an awful lot of calendars with blanket guidance like prune in wintry weather or trim in summer time. Those legislation are too blunt. Timing rides on species, local weather, and the goal.

Dormant season pruning, late iciness in lots of regions, reduces sap circulate and minimizes disease spread in species vulnerable to bleeding. It also provides a clear view of format. Structural differences in alright, elms, and maples occasionally match this window. The tradeoff is that dormant pruning can stimulate full of life spring increase, that's beneficial while you’re building format and unhelpful for those who’re looking to sluggish a tree down.

Summer pruning and mild trimming can diminish expansion by way of taking away leaves whilst the tree is actively photosynthesizing. If a maple overshadows a garden bed, a mid season relief can allow in sun without frightening the same flush you’d get from a overdue wintry weather reduce. For cherries and plums prone to silver leaf and canker, dry summer season cuts minimize irritation hazard. Conversely, forestall heavy summer time work in warmness waves; it stresses the tree and raises water call for.

Avoid pruning at some stage in moist spells for species susceptible to sicknesses that trip moisture and recent wounds. Oak wilt menace varies regionally, however the ordinary counsel is to circumvent pruning okay in the course of lively beetle flight durations which may run from spring into mid summer season. When unsure, test local extension advisories.

Species count more than many think

Pruning a beech is just not almost like pruning a crape myrtle or a pine. Pay awareness to wood anatomy, progress addiction, and illness risks.

Oaks choose minimal, smartly considered cuts. Their slower compartmentalization makes smooth technique imperative. I’d as an alternative make a number of considerate reductions than many small nips.

Birches and maples bleed sap in late winter if reduce close to bud ruin. Bleeding is customarily beauty, yet in the event you would like to dodge it, wait except leaves are entirely out.

Stone fruit improvement from annual pruning that eliminates inward improvement and improves air stream. Peach wooden bears fruit on last year’s shoots, so renewal pruning is vital to prevent young fruiting wood coming.

Conifers don’t reply to not easy lower back cuts the approach broadleaf trees do. On pines, you'll pinch candles to handle size, but reducing again into old wood that lacks needles gained’t regenerate. On arborvitae, you can trim gently on efficient assistance, but cutting lower back into naked inside stems received’t produce new foliage.

Mature timber with decay pockets, useless tops, or lightning scars require restraint. I probably advise staged work over two or three seasons, specially if the tree is successful. Taking an excessive amount of reside tissue instantly can tip a marginal tree toward decline.

What a skilled looks for beforehand cutting

When I’m generally known as to judge a tree, I don’t commence with saws. I start with questions and a walk around.

First, what are the proprietor’s goals? Light for a vegetable bed, clearance for beginning trucks, less particles in a pool, or a safer play region underneath the cover? Goals drive the process.

Second, how does the tree convey itself? I assess trunk flare, soil grade variations, fungus bodies, and ancient pruning wounds. I observe lean, prevailing wind, and how the cover distributes weight over the bottom. A heavy cantilevered limb over a roof might simplest desire a small discount back to a stable lateral, but sometimes a cabling gadget is a wiser adjunct to pruning.

Third, how tons dwell tissue will we cast off thoroughly? If the tree is drought stressed out, pest ridden, or newly transplanted, I trim expectations and stage the paintings. I’d particularly restore a risk and defer cosmetic requests than push a harassed tree to the sting.

Only after this scan do I mark cuts. On a titanic process, I’ve chalked and flagged dozens of elements so the climber and floor group percentage the same plan. This making plans step is the big difference between a easy, useful prune and a rushed trim.

Safety and menace: in which trimming becomes a liability

I have grew to become down paintings whilst the request was once “take as an awful lot as one could to make it small.” Over reduction, mainly often called lion’s tailing while inside branches are stripped and all foliage is left on ends, creates whips that snap late in storms. Topping - chopping back to stubs without laterals - is worse. It is immediate, it can be lower priced, and it creates a preservation entice with weakly attached clusters of sprouts. Municipalities oftentimes nonetheless require topping less than excessive lines as a result of clearance mandates, however for personal timber, it’s a last motel of course other selections fail.

On the flip side, no longer touching a tree should be its own menace. Deadwood over a patio, cracked limbs with included bark, and branches rubbing shingles are preventable issues. Pruning permits you to lessen chance without compromising the tree’s destiny. A proper rule: should you want to put off extra than a quarter of the stay crown on a mature tree to fulfill your desires, step again and reassess. There may well be improved solutions like focused discounts, selective removals of competing limbs, or perhaps planting a secondary tree to take over the position so you can gradually decrease the 1st.

Homeowner blunders I see over and over

Shearing a tree as though it were a hedge is the high mistake. The 2nd is reducing too with reference to the trunk, casting off the department collar. Those flush cuts glance neat to start with, yet they slow closure and invite decay. Third is ladder paintings with out tie in issues. Every 12 months, I listen about falls from aluminum ladders into stay branches with a observed in hand. If you can still’t attain it properly with each feet planted and a sharp hand observed, rent any person who can climb or deliver a lift.

Another commonly used misstep is cleaning out the internal and leaving foliage purely at the hints. It looks airy within the quick time period and seems like you “lightened” the tree, however you've got improved leverage and wind sail on the very ends, which raises the threat of breakage.

Finally, cutting at the incorrect time for the species is popular. For occasion, heavy late summer cuts on a sugar maple prior to a drought stretch can cause facet browning and pressure that carries into wintry weather. The more suitable stream is to stay up for a funky, secure length or push structural adjustments to dormancy if affliction menace is low.

Tools, technique, and clean work

Sharp methods modification the whole thing. A proper sharpened hand observed cuts sooner and cleanser than a dull chainsaw run through a frightened arm at complete extension. For such a lot residential pruning underneath four inches in diameter, a hand saw and pass pruners are the appropriate equipment. Use a 3 cut technique on better branches to keep away from bark tearing: an undercut a brief distance from the trunk, a peak cut outdoors that to drop the load, then a ultimate fresh reduce simply out of doors the department collar.

Disinfecting equipment between bushes is a straight forward behavior that things whilst hearth blight or different pathogens are in play. A spray bottle with 70 % isopropyl alcohol does the task. It’s not essential on each minimize, but that's prudent when moving among timber of the similar susceptible species all over a plague.

Make cuts that acknowledge taper and load paths. If you might be cutting back an extended lateral, opt for a good subordinate department that is Fort Lauderdale tree service no less than a third the diameter of the guardian. Take care no longer to depart stubs, which die to come back and feed decay.

A case gain knowledge of: two maples, two approaches

On one assets, the front yard sugar maple had grown over the driveway. The owner asked for “a tidy trim.” I suggested selective mark downs and thinning as an alternative. We eliminated 3 crossing branches, shortened two leaders to come back to effectively located laterals, and took out deadwood. The crown retained its usual structure, and we opened a corridor over the drive with no flat topping the cover. Three years later, the structure remained strong, and the regrowth blended.

In the outside, a Norway maple leaned towards the neighbor’s storage. It had been crowned years past and was loaded with water sprouts. Here, trimming may were lipstick on a pig. We staged a two yr plan. Year one, we eliminated a competing leader with a sparkling removing lower and decreased 3 lengthy limbs to gradual the lean’s momentum. We also thinned congested areas to scale down sail. Year two, we got here back to refine mark downs and install a non invasive cable between two main leaders to share load. The tree nevertheless isn’t just right - crowned bushes not often are - but danger dropped dramatically, and the preservation c program languageperiod lengthened.

Setting a practical renovation rhythm

Trees do not favor monthly grooming. They would like a clean shape early, periodic assessments, and distinct paintings. A rhythm I use on many web sites:

  • Years 1 to five after planting: identify a dominant leader, house scaffold branches, eradicate or diminish co-dominant stems early, and right kind crossing limbs. One mild prune each and every 1 to 2 years.
  • Years 6 to fifteen: cost every 2 to a few years for clearance wishes, deadwood, and balance. Make modest mark downs wherein limbs outrun the cover.
  • Mature part: investigate every 3 to five years, with extra common checks after leading storms. Focus on deadwood, menace reduction, and easy structural modifications. Avoid gigantic dwell crown removals unless there is a transparent protection purpose.

For hedges and formal displays, trimming durations may well be tighter, ordinarily two to 4 occasions in line with transforming into season based on species and vigour. Keep hedges reasonably wider at the bottom than the higher so cut foliage receives easy. That one aspect keeps hedges stuffed and decreases woody gaps.
